Protecting Your Cognitive Function

Start by implementing digital boundaries that protect your brain’s recovery time. Create phone-free zones in your bedroom and dining areas, and establish specific times when devices are off-limits.

Replace mindless scrolling with activities that promote neuroplasticity. Reading physical books, solving puzzles, or learning new skills helps rebuild the neural pathways damaged by constant digital stimulation.

Practice single-tasking throughout your day. Focus on one activity at a time, whether it’s responding to emails or having a conversation, to retrain your brain’s attention systems and reduce cognitive load.

Brain Protection Action Plan

  • Set your phone to grayscale mode to reduce visual stimulation and addictive appeal
  • Use the 20-20-20 rule: every 20 minutes, look at something 20 feet away for 20 seconds
  • Create a charging station outside your bedroom and use an analog alarm clock
  • Schedule specific times for checking emails and social media rather than responding immediately
  • Take a 10-minute walk without any devices every few hours to reset your attention span

The Sleep Connection Factor

Sleep quality amplifies the brain-aging effects of excessive screen time in ways most people overlook. When you use devices within two hours of bedtime, the blue light exposure disrupts your brain’s natural cleaning process that occurs during deep sleep.

During quality sleep, your brain’s glymphatic system flushes out metabolic waste and toxic proteins. Screen-induced sleep disruption impairs this crucial detox process, allowing harmful substances to accumulate and accelerate cognitive decline.
